Approach Resources Inc. Reports First Quarter 2015 Results

Loading...
Loading...
FORT WORTH, Texas--(BUSINESS WIRE)--

Approach Resources Inc. AREX today reported results for first quarter 2015. Highlights for first quarter 2015 include:

  • Production was 14.3 MBoe/d, a 21% increase over the prior-year quarter
  • EBITDAX was $33.4 million, or $0.83 per diluted share
  • Per unit cash operating expenses decreased 27% from the prior-year period
  • Adjusted net loss was $1.3 million, or $0.03 per diluted share
  • Average IP for horizontal Wolfcamp wells in first quarter 2015 was 723 Boe/d (56% oil)
  • Lenders reaffirmed credit facility commitment amount of $450 million effective April 15

Management Comment

J. Ross Craft, Approach's Chairman, Chief Executive Officer and President, commented, "In June of 2014, WTI oil prices peaked at $107.26 per barrel. On November 27, 2014, OPEC, under the guidance of Saudi Arabia, announced that it would not curtail oil production volumes. Over the next two months, WTI oil fell from $73.69 per barrel to $44.45 per barrel in January 2015, a 59% decrease from its high in June 2014. Due to this free fall in pricing, we elected to suspend our December 2014 completions until we could secure meaningful drilling and completion cost reductions. In anticipation of back loading first quarter 2015 completions, along with some minor weather-related down time, we guided the market toward lower production for first quarter 2015 compared to fourth quarter 2014. During the first quarter 2015, we concentrated our efforts on identifying and implementing various cost-reduction initiatives and completing our backlog of uncompleted wells. I am pleased to report our current well costs have been reduced to approximately $4.6 million as a result of our water recycling facility and service cost concessions. In addition, we have reduced lease operating expense by 25%, cash general and administrative expense by 17%, and depletion, depreciation and amortization expense by 7% on a year-over-year per Boe basis. We remain on track to achieve our 2015 goals of protecting our balance sheet and exiting this price cycle as a leaner and more efficient company positioned to capture upside for our investors as crude oil prices recover."

First Quarter 2015 Results

Production for first quarter 2015 totaled 1,287 MBoe (14.3 MBoe/d), compared to 1,067 MBoe (11.9 MBoe/d) in first quarter 2014, a 21% increase. Due to the planned back loading of completions in first quarter 2015, reduction in NGL volumes as a result of ethane rejection at our NGL processing point of sale and minor weather-related issues, first quarter 2015 production decreased 7%, compared to fourth quarter 2014 production of 1,390 MBoe (15.1 MBoe/d). Oil production for first quarter 2015 increased 10% to 493 MBbls, compared to 450 MBbls produced in first quarter 2014. Production for first quarter 2015 was 67% liquids (38% oil and 29% NGLs) and 33% natural gas.

Net loss for first quarter 2015 was $7.7 million, or $0.19 per diluted share, on revenues of $33.3 million. This compares to net income for first quarter 2014 of $2.9 million, or $0.08 per diluted share, on revenues of $61.9 million. Net income for first quarter 2015 included a realized gain on commodity derivatives of $15.9 million and an unrealized loss on commodity derivatives of $9.3 million.

Excluding the unrealized loss on commodity derivatives, rig termination fee and related income taxes, adjusted net loss (non-GAAP) for first quarter 2015 was $1.3 million, or $0.03 per diluted share, compared to adjusted net income of $6.9 million, or $0.17 per diluted share, for first quarter 2014. EBITDAX (non-GAAP) for first quarter 2015 was $33.4 million, or $0.83 per diluted share, compared to $42.7 million, or $1.09 per diluted share, for first quarter 2014. See "Supplemental Non-GAAP Financial and Other Measures" below for our reconciliation of adjusted net (loss) income and EBITDAX to net (loss) income.

Our average realized commodity price for first quarter 2015, before the effect of commodity derivatives, was $25.87 per Boe. This compares to an average realized price of $58.04 per Boe in the first quarter of 2014. Our average realized price, including the effect of commodity derivatives, was $38.23 per Boe for first quarter 2015.

Lease operating expense ("LOE") averaged $5.55 per Boe for first quarter 2015. This represents a decrease of $1.81 per Boe or a 25% decrease on a year-over-year basis. Sequentially, our LOE decreased $1.10 from $6.65 per Boe or 17%. Production and ad valorem taxes averaged $2.20 per Boe, or 8.5% of oil, NGL and gas sales. Exploration costs were $0.85 per Boe and includes a rig termination fee of $0.5 million. Cash general and administrative costs averaged $4.58 per Boe, a 17% decrease compared to the prior-year quarter. Depletion, depreciation and amortization expense averaged $20.61 per Boe, a 7% decrease on a year-over-year basis. Interest expense totaled $5.9 million.

Operations Update

During first quarter 2015, we drilled eight, and completed 13, horizontal Wolfcamp wells. Seven wells targeted the Wolfcamp B bench and six wells targeted the Wolfcamp C bench. A total of 11 wells were turned to sales during the quarter including five located on our University lease and six located on our Baker lease. Of the wells completed since our year-end operations update, the average initial 24-hour rate for wells turned online during first quarter 2015 was 723 Boe/d (56% oil). At quarter-end, eight wells were waiting on completion.

Costs incurred during first quarter 2015 totaled $74.6 million and included $68.2 million for drilling and completion activities, $6 million for infrastructure projects and equipment, and $0.4 million for lease extensions.

Liquidity Update

At March 31, 2015, we had a $1 billion senior secured credit facility in place, with aggregate lender commitments of $450 million and borrowing base of $600 million. In April, our lenders reaffirmed the commitment amount of $450 million, while reducing the borrowing base to $525 million. At March 31, 2015, our liquidity and long-term debt-to-capital ratio were approximately $240 million and 37.4%, respectively. About Approach Resources

Approach Resources Inc. is an independent energy company focused on the exploration, development, production and acquisition of unconventional oil and gas reserves in the Midland Basin of the greater Permian Basin in West Texas. EBITDAX

We define EBITDAX as net (loss) income, plus (1) exploration expense, (2) depletion, depreciation and amortization expense, (3) share-based compensation expense, (4) unrealized loss on commodity derivatives, (5) interest expense, net, and (6) income tax (benefit) provision. EBITDAX is not a measure of net income or cash flow as determined by GAAP. The amounts included in the calculation of EBITDAX were computed in accordance with GAAP. EBITDAX is presented herein and reconciled to the GAAP measure of net income because of its wide acceptance by the investment community as a financial indicator of a company's ability to internally fund development and exploration activities. Long-Term Debt-to-Capital

Long-term debt-to-capital ratio is calculated by dividing long-term debt (GAAP) by the sum of total stockholders' equity (GAAP) and long-term debt (GAAP). We use the long-term debt-to-capital ratio as a measurement of our overall financial leverage. However, this ratio has limitations.
